Little Nippers Green
The Festival’s Happiest Place for Families!
Discover Little Nippers Green, a brand-new family zone at the St Ives Food & Drink Festival, packed with fun for children and their grown-ups.
From hands-on cooking with Rose Cant (Saturday, 10am – booking required) to creative activities like face painting, pebble painting, food printing and sensory play, there’s plenty to spark young imaginations.
Enjoy circus skills workshops (Sat & Sun, 2–4pm), lively music sessions (Sunday, 11am & 1pm), and a bouncy castle running all weekend.
All activities are designed for fun, creativity and exploration, with adult supervision required.

Little Chefs with Rose Cant – Saturday 10am
Aprons on, hands ready! Children can join Rose Cant (who you might know as Mum on Muddy Lane on Instagram) for fun, interactive cooking classes.
Roll up your sleeves and get ready to make your very own pasta salad!
Kids (or pairs of kids) can choose their favourite ingredients, explore different flavours, and learn how to build a dish with exciting textures and tastes.
We’ll talk about sauces, how to mix fats and acids to make them yummy, and even experiment with simple techniques – all in a fun, hands-on way. It’s a mini food adventure where every child can create something of their own and learn some food facts to takeaway.
There will be chefs’ hats and aprons to wear, plus prizes for the best flavoured, best looking and most inventive pasta creation!
The sessions are free to attend but you’ll need to book a place in advance.
